Transaction 18688f2b9c87efbb8794e81bbc67a2d8f44bb34ea5099dc33e98bf98097b1185
1 Input
1 Output
-
18688f2b9c87efbb8794e81bbc67a2d8f44bb34ea5099dc33e98bf98097b1185:0
- value
- 33175310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e4db9dcaa115095f5326eca514822cf69c1bec2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19bddXnje7ERE7Qos3WvkwwyjkBknmS3AW